La Revoada is Gabriel García Márquez's first novel and the first appearance of Macondo—a town that would become famous with the success of One Hundred Years of Solitude. Between 1903 and 1928, three characters recount different versions of the village through interior monologues: an elderly colonel, his daughter Isabel, and his grandson. However, for the author, the central character of the book is a strange and taciturn doctor who, after living in isolation and committing suicide, has his body mourned by his three relatives. Gabriel García Márquez was 22 when he wrote La Revoada, his debut novel (also published in Brazil as The Devil's Burial). The book already shows that the author was already a master long before his career took off. It is in this work that the fascinating people of Macondo emerge - Meme, the Dog, Adelaida, Martín, Pedro Ángel, with their dramas and superstitions, their dreams and manias - and the fantastic atmosphere of the village, the insects, the smell of damp earth, a setting where everything passes like a flurry, the days and nights, life and death.","brand":"Totvsrj-record-dc","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47159410065660,"sku":"9788501011817","price":69.9,"currency_code":"BRL","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0722\/9197\/5420\/files\/2636880d39c37c1bc04d95f28a0f6fc1.jpg?v=1778642104","url":"https:\/\/www.record.com.br\/en\/products\/a-revoada-o-enterro-do-diabo","provider":"Editora Record","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
